Issued: September 27, 2003

BALANCED OFFENSE LEADS BLUGOLDS OVER RIVER FALLS

RIVER FALLS - The UW-Eau Claire football team rushed for 178 yards and passed for 238 more en rout to a 42-28 victory over River Falls in the WIAC opener here today at Ramer Field.

The Blugolds move to 2-1 on the season and 1-0 in WIAC action while the Falcons fall to 0-3 for the season and 0-1 in conference play.

The Falcons got the scoring started on their second possession with a 14 play, 85-yard drive capped off by a John Peterlik 10-yard touchdown run to put River Falls up 7-0 in the first quarter. The drive was kept alive by Owen Schmitt who ran four yards on fourth and three to set up the touchdown.

The Blugolds responded early in the second quarter when Nels Fredrickson (Sr.-Burnsville) hooked up with Matt Evensen (So.-Junction City/Auburndale) for a 17-yard touchdown pass to knot the game at seven.

After a short Falcon punt, it was Evensen getting in the end ` zone again, this time with a 23-yard wide receiver reverse to give the Blugolds a 14-7 advantage. Both teams were held in check the remainder of the half and the Blugolds took a seven point lead into the locker room.

On the first possession of the second half the Falcons put together an impressive 12 play, 81-yard drive highlighted by a 29 yard pass from Troy Foss to Peterlik. Peterlik later ran the ball into the end zone from a yard out to tie the game at 14.

On Eau Claire's next possession Fredrickson struck again, this time with a 61-yard pass to Erik Ferguson (Sr.-Rochester, MN/Dover-Eyota) to bring the ball to the River Falls 18-yard line. Two plays later Brian Mitchell (So.-Carol Stream, IL) ran 12 yards for the touchdown. The extra point was no good but the Blugolds regained the lead at 20-14.

It took just two plays for the Blugolds to get the ball back as Mike Lansing (Jr.-Janesville/Craig) picked off a Troy Foss pass on the River Falls 28-yard line. After a Blugold first down, Joe Gast (So.-Waconia, MN) rushed for a five-yard touchdown. Fredrickson hit Ferguson on the two-point conversion attempt and the score was 28-14.

After another short Falcon punt, Fredrickson used his legs to keep the drive rolling as he ran up the middle for 27 yards. Two plays later he completed a nine-yard touchdown pass to Ferguson to give the Blugolds a 35-14 lead.

Jeremy Darnell (Jr.-Owen/Withee) hit Evensen for a 25-yard touchdown pass on the next possession to widen the lead to 42-14. The Falcons score a touchdown late in the third quarter and another in the fourth but it wasn't enough to overcome the Blugolds as the final score was 42-28 in favor of Eau Claire.

Fredrickson finished the day 14-of-26 for 187 yards and two touchdowns and did not throw an interception. Evensen caught eight passes for 98 yards and two touchdowns while also running one time for a 23-yard touchdown. Don Kahl (Jr.-Brookfield/East) caught six passes for 62 yards while Ferguson caught two balls for 70 yards and a touchdown.

Mitchell was the Blugolds leading rusher with 79 yards on 17 carries and a touchdown while Gast ran 11 times for 54 yards and a touchdown.

Pat Cummings (Sr.-Rochester, MN/John Marshall) helped lead the Blugold defense with 11 tackles while Lansing recorded 10 tackles to go along with an interception and a fumble recovery. Austin Crow (Sr.-Woodbury, MN) added nine tackles and had two of the Blugolds five sacks on the day. Billy Dierks (Sr.-Goodhue, MN) grabbed an interception to go along with two tackles.

Eau Claire will battle Bethel College next week in the Blugolds homecoming game at Carson Park. Last season Eau Claire scored a decisive 40-0 victory over the Royals.
